Ally
McBeal often sports a wistful, dreamy, slightly melancholy look. That's
when you want to pay close attention, because right after that, the lights
go on somewhere inside Ally. You begin to see her build that secretive
"cat that swallowed the canary" smile. It's a mischievous look
and now it's anyone's guess just what she will do or say next.
Who
the heck is Ally McBeal really? Could she be the hidden self inside us
all, saying and doing what we wish we could, if we only had the guts, if
only we dared?
Ally
is outrageous, controversial, wistful and even waif-like. She's been left
out in the cold, she's smart, she's lonely, she's gifted, she's surrounded
by friends who love her, she speaks her mind and she's gainfully employed
as a lawyer in Boston. In short, she is an amalgam (and a contradiction)
of a half dozen people or more. She'll show you all her varied sides with
no apology.
Neptune
Poster Child
Ally
expresses a decidedly Neptunian energy. What's that you say? Well, it’s
that dreamy, magical, slightly hazy, loopy, quizzical, prophetic kind of
presentation. Neptune is noted for imagination, fantasy, escape, empathy,
romance, artistry and blending. Her internal dialogue and her vivid visual
images are part of the artistic and dreamy imagination that Neptune
imparts to us. There are many ways to use (and abuse) the Neptune factor
that exists in all of us.
Ally seems to
have found the perfect outlet for her intense reactions to people and
life. She plays out exactly what she wants to do, in fantasy, and then
she quickly regroups, acting almost normal, and adapting to the situation
at hand. It's a fascinating interplay of inner and outer reality.
Do
actresses in some way resemble the roles they make famous? Is Ally McBeal
wildly successful because Calista Flockhart, the actress who portrays her,
is more than a little like her? Ally's vivid imagination and fantasy games
are easily seen in Calista's birth Sun in Scorpio conjunct (both planets
at or near the same degree and sign) Neptune, also in Scorpio.
The
Sun (basic character) in water sign Scorpio is intense, deep-feeling,
magnetic and often compulsive. Influenced by Neptune, the Sun quickly
becomes obsessed by certain fantasies, is very sensitive and nurses an
overactive imagination. Neptune represents the necessary escape we all
seek and find (in our own favorite ways) from the perplexities, pain and
disappointments of life. Ally channels her fear, pain, longing, jealousies
and anger into very realistic images that enact her wildest fantasies of
what she'd really like to say or do. These essentially harmless enactments
obviously help her resolve and release her emotional turmoil.
To be as successful
as she is, Calista Flockhart must identify with this aspect of Ally.
Being an actress demands that you fully "become" someone else for
the duration of the role. Neptune, the smooth flowing shape-shifter,
allows Calista to blend easily by removing the barriers and boundaries
so she can merge with the character of Ally McBeal.
Direct
Communication
Ally McBeal's
character is a smart, sassy, wide-eyed and successful lawyer, with a
compassionate heart. Calista portrays Ally's verbal skillfulness through
her Mercury (mode of communication) in Sagittarius. Mercury placed in
the fire sign Sagittarius can make a case for just about anything and
then sell it to you wholesale.
This
is a precocious, witty, wise and simultaneously irreverent position
for endless verbal banter and continual internal/external yarn spinning.
Essentially a positive risk-taker and somewhat prone to exaggeration,
Mercury in Sagittarius is joyous, outspoken and a conversational gambler.
It's especially fond of the verbal twists and traps that make a great
lawyer!
Aquarian
Controversy
Calista
Flockhart is no stranger to controversy with her birth Moon in the unique,
individualistic sign of Aquarius. This fits Ally perfectly. Ally McBeal
thrives by active and endless involvement in one controversial situation
after another. People with Moon in Aquarius learn early that the manner of
their upbringing or way of perceiving life is not like everyone else's.
They are considered by others to be unconventional, counterculture or even
eccentric.
Moon in Aquarius natives eventually examine all the sacred cows
of the culture and challenge them one by one, eventually forging their own
individualistic reality. This creative, independent, erratic and often
abrupt Moon can feel lonely or displaced, and finds solace with groups of
friends who are equally unusual or at least tolerate the Aquarian Moon's
uniqueness. Could this be Ally? Could this be the selfsame alienation we
identify with?
